Atchison,
Topeka & Santa Fe
Road Number SFR B 5932
50’ Standard Box Car, Plug Door
P/N: 038 00 450
|
|
This
50’ standard
box car with plug doors is painted ATSF Indian
Red with black
ends and orange doors. Displaying the “SHOCK
CONTROL” slogan with the large “Santa
Fe Circle/Cross” logo in white,
it runs on black Barber® roller bearing trucks.
This car is one of 200 “Shoc k Control/A
Smoother Ride” insulated
RBL refrigerator cars built in the Santa Fe
shops in January of
1960. This class RR-64 car was serviced at
Santa Fe’s Topeka Shops in March of 1973. The
orange door indicates
this car is “DF Loader”, “Damage
Free” equipped. |

Missouri-Kansas-Texas®
Road Number MKT 12447
50’ Steel Side 15-panel Gondola w/fixed ends
P/N: 105 00 590
|
|
This
50’ steel side 15-panel gondola with
fixed ends is painted Whitman green with white
lettering and runs on black Barber® roller
bearing trucks. Built by Ortner Freight Car Company in August of 1979, #12447 was added
to this series of 100 cars that originally consisted
of Thrall cars built
in 1967. These cars were used for general
service duties and features included steel floors
and fixed
ends. |

Arcade & Attica
Railroad
Road Number ARA 506
40’ Standard Boxcar w/Superior door - no roofwalk
P/N: 024 00 330 |
|
This
40’ standard box car with single Superior
door and no roofwalk is painted
Armour yellow with a lower white stripe. The
lettering, including the large “ARA” herald
and “Serving Arcade Industry” slogan,
is black and white. It was built in the late
1930s, and rebuilt in June 1956. It runs on black Bettendorf
trucks.
It was repainted in July 1970 when it became
a secondhand purchase
for the ARA, then numbered into the 501-509 series. The
ARA included 22 rolling stock in the 1973
Official Railway and Equipment Registry that were
all but gone by 1978. |

Rock
Island
Road Number RI 1176
50’ Composite Gondola w/Drop Ends,
& fishbelly sides
P/N: 062 00 040
|
|
This
box car red 50’ composite gondola with
drop ends, and fishbelly sides has large white ‘ROCK
ISLAND” lettering
and runs on black Bettendorf trucks. Rock
Island’s 400 ‘War Emergency’ gondolas
were built by Pressed Steel Car Company in November
of 1943. When new, #1176 received this box car red paint
and white stenciling. Equipped with 70-ton
Bettendorf style
trucks, the cars were of 140,000-pound capacity
and 1673
cubic feet. The Rock Island later converted
these cars to adapt in TOFC service, tie loading
and steel service.

Burlington
Northern
Road Number BN 435755
Two-bay
ACF Center Flow® Covered Hopper
P/N: 092 00 080
|
|
This
BN green two-bay ACF Center Flow® covered
hopper with round hatches has
large white ‘Burlington Northern” lettering,
white BN logo and white lettering,
and runs on black Barber® roller
bearing trucks. One of 50 two-bay covered hoppers
built by ACF in the
mid-1970s, this car was originally numbered into
the NP series 75000-75099. The 100-car series was
later numbered for the Burlington Northern into
series 435700-435799. Within this group, some
were painted gray
with black lettering and some were painted green
with white lettering. The hoppers
were used for hauling
cement through Portland, OR, silica sand out of
the Ottawa, IL, area and bentonite
clay from Wyoming for use in drilling oil wells. |

New
Haven
Road Number NH 31728
40’ Standard Boxcar, with Superior door
P/N: #500 00 460
|
|
This
40’ standard box car, with single Superior
door is painted red with large black and
white ‘NH’ letters and white lettering.
It runs on black Bettendorf trucks. Built
in October of 1944
by Pullman-Standard in Hammond, IN, it was equipped
with six-foot doors and Dreadnaught
ends. It was
repainted at Readville, MA, in February 1956. The
#31000-32999 road series was the largest block
of cars delivered
to the New Haven during World II. |

Spokane,
Portland & Seattle
Road Number S.P. & S. 10053
40’ Double sheathed wood box car with single
door and vertical brake wheel
P/N: #515 00 140 |
|
This
40’ double sheathed wood box car with
single doors and vertical brake wheel is painted
box car red with large white “Spokane,
Portland & Seattle” letters and runs
on brown Andrews
trucks. In August 1918, the
United States Railroad Administration [USRA]
allocated 300 new 40-ft, double
sheathed, wood box cars to the SP&S.
The parent lines G.N. & N.P. conceded
and on February 18, 1920, the SP&S entered into an equipment trust with USRA
and received the 300 “modern” steel
underframe box cars. These
were assigned to the 10000-10299 series. |
